2004-01-07 Michael Koch <konqueror@gmx.de>

* java/text/CollationElementIterator.java
	(textIndex): Renamed from index.
	* java/text/CollationKey.java
	(collator): New member.
	(CollationKey): New argument for parent collator.
	(equals): Check for same collator, source string and key array.
	* java/text/RuleBasedCollator.java:
	Reformated.
	(RuleBasedCollator): Don't re-initialize frenchAccents with default
	value.
	(getCollationElementIterator): Rewritten.
	(getCollationKey): Added new argument to CollationKey constructor.

From-SVN: r75510
